What Is a Data Certification?

A data certification is proof that you have learned important data-related skills. It shows employers that you understand topics like data analysis, visualization, reporting, and problem-solving.

Most certification programs include training and assessments that test your knowledge. Once you complete the course and pass the exam, you receive a certificate that can be added to your resume and LinkedIn profile.

Data certifications are useful because they focus on industry-relevant skills that companies actually need.

Important Skills You Learn in a Data Certification Program

A quality data certification program focuses on both technical and practical knowledge.

Here are some important skills you usually learn.

Data Analysis

Data analysis means studying information to identify patterns and insights. This helps businesses make informed decisions.

You learn how to:

  • Read data

  • Clean data

  • Organize information

  • Find trends

  • Solve business problems

Excel Skills

Microsoft Excel remains one of the most widely used tools in the business world.

You learn:

  • Formulas

  • Pivot tables

  • Charts

  • Data filtering

  • Reporting

Excel skills are useful in almost every industry.

SQL Basics

SQL is used to manage and retrieve data from databases.

You learn how to:

  • Extract data

  • Filter records

  • Create reports

  • Work with databases

SQL is one of the most important skills for data professionals.

Data Visualization

Data visualization helps present information in a simple and visual format.

You learn how to create:

  • Dashboards

  • Charts

  • Graphs

  • Visual reports

Good visualization makes business information easier to understand.

Popular Career Roles After Data Certification

A data certification can open doors to many career opportunities.

Some common job roles include:

Data Analyst

Data analysts study information and create reports that help companies make better decisions.

Responsibilities include:

  • Analyzing business data

  • Preparing dashboards

  • Creating reports

  • Finding trends

Business Analyst

Business analysts help organizations improve processes and business performance.

They work closely with management teams and data systems.

Reporting Analyst

Reporting analysts create regular reports for businesses using data tools and dashboards.

They help track performance and business growth.

Operations Analyst

Operations analysts study company operations and identify areas for improvement.

They use data to improve efficiency and productivity.

Junior Data Consultant

Consultants support businesses by analyzing information and suggesting improvements.

This role is suitable for professionals with strong analytical skills.
